#topBar{ width:100%; height:41px; background:url(topBar.gif) repeat-x 0 top; position:fixed; _position:absolute; _top: expression(documentElement.scrollTop + "px"); top:0; left:0; z-index:1000; }
#topBar .topContent{ width:980px; height:41px; margin:0 auto; _visibility:visible; _overflow:hidden; }
.topnav{ float:left; width:400px; height:41px;}
.topnav li{ float:left; padding-right:5px;}
.topnav a.none, .topnav a.gg{ display:inline-block; width:90px; height:41px; font:bold 20px/41px "微软雅黑"; color:#fff; text-align:center; background:url(top_img.gif) no-repeat 73px 20px;}
.topnav a.none, .topnav a.none:hover{ text-decoration:none; background:url(topNav.gif) repeat-x;}
.topnav a.none:visited, .topnav a.gg:visited{ color:#fff;}
.topnav a.gg:hover{ text-decoration:none;}
.topc{ clear:both; width:980px; height:76px; margin:0 auto; /*overflow:hidden;*/}
.topc .logo{float:left; display:inline;}
.topc .logo a{ display:inline-block; width:203px; height:54px; padding:11px 6px;}
.topc_img{ float:right; padding:14px 20px 0 0;}
.topc_img li{ float:left; padding-left:20px;}
.topc_img a{ display:inline-block; width:50px; height:12px; padding-top:38px; text-align:center; background:url(top_img.gif) no-repeat;}
.topc_img a.img1{ background-position:2px -23px;}
.topc_img a.img2{ background-position:2px -80px;}
.topc_img a.img3{ background-position:2px -136px;}
.topc_img a.img4{ background-position:0px -609px;}

.nav{ clear:both; width:979px; height:84px; margin:0 auto; padding-right:1px; background:url(top_img.gif) no-repeat right -432px;}
.nav .l{ float:left; width:1px; height:84px; background:url(top_img.gif) no-repeat 0 -432px;}
.nav .channel{ float:left; width:956px; height:65px; padding:19px 0 0 22px;; background:url(top_img.gif) repeat-x 0 -516px; overflow:hidden;}
.nav .channel li{ width:auto; height:24px; font:14px/24px "宋体";}
.nav .channel li a{ padding:0 12px;}
.channel #shop{ float:left; width:229px; height:48px; padding-left:51px; background:url(top_img.gif) no-repeat -49px -231px; overflow:hidden;}
.channel #life{ float:left; width:392px; height:48px; padding-left:56px; background:url(top_img.gif) no-repeat -44px -298px; overflow:hidden;}
.channel #gy{ float:right; width:174px; height:48px; padding-left:51px; background:url(top_img.gif) no-repeat -49px -365px; overflow:hidden;}

/*顶部下拉菜单*/
#sddm{ float:left; width:380px; height:41px; margin:0 auto; padding:0; z-index:30;}
#sddm #m1, #sddm #m2, #sddm #m3{ width:90px; height:auto; background:url(70a.png); _background:none;/*IE6*/_filter: prog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led='true', sizingMethod='scale', src="http://www.zhanjiang.cc/index/70a.png"); position:relative; left:7px}
#sddm div{ margin-top:-4px; padding:0 0 5px; border-top:4px solid #8d0d0c; display:none; z-index:999;}
#sddm div a{ width:58px; height:30px; margin:0; padding:0 0 0 32px; color:#fff; font:12px/30px "宋体"; _line-height:34px; text-align:left; white-space:nowrap; background:url(topNav_img.png) no-repeat; _background:url(topNav_img.gif) no-repeat; position:relative; display:block; overflow:hidden;}
#sddm div a:hover{ text-decoration:none; background:url(topNav_img.png) no-repeat #ffae00; _background:url(topNav_img1.gif) no-repeat #ffae00;}
#sddm div a.m1_2, #sddm div a.m1_2:hover{ background-position:0 -30px;}
#sddm div a.m1_3, #sddm div a.m1_3:hover{ background-position:0 -60px;}
#sddm div a.m1_4, #sddm div a.m1_4:hover{ background-position:0 -90px;}
#sddm div a.m1_5, #sddm div a.m1_5:hover{ background-position:0 -120px;}
#sddm div a.m1_6, #sddm div a.m1_6:hover{ background-position:0 -150px;}
#sddm div a.m1_7, #sddm div a.m1_7:hover{ background-position:0 -180px;}
#sddm div a.m1_8, #sddm div a.m1_8:hover{ background-position:0 -210px;}
#sddm div a.m2_1, #sddm div a.m2_1:hover{ background-position:-90px 0;}
#sddm div a.m2_2, #sddm div a.m2_2:hover{ background-position:-90px -30px;}
#sddm div a.m2_3, #sddm div a.m2_3:hover{ background-position:-90px -60px;}
#sddm div a.m2_4, #sddm div a.m2_4:hover{ background-position:-90px -90px;}
#sddm div a.m2_5, #sddm div a.m2_5:hover{ background-position:-90px -120px;}
#sddm div a.m2_6, #sddm div a.m2_6:hover{ background-position:-90px -150px;}
#sddm div a.m2_7, #sddm div a.m2_7:hover{ background-position:-90px -180px;}
#sddm div a.m2_8, #sddm div a.m2_8:hover{ background-position:-90px -210px;}
#sddm div a.m2_9, #sddm div a.m2_9:hover{ background-position:-90px -240px;}
#sddm div a.m2_10, #sddm div a.m2_10:hover{ background-position:-90px -270px;}
#sddm div a.m3_1, #sddm div a.m3_1:hover{ background-position:-180px 0;}
#sddm div a.m3_2, #sddm div a.m3_2:hover{ background-position:-180px -30px;}
#sddm div a.m3_3, #sddm div a.m3_3:hover{ background-position:-180px -60px;}
#sddm div a.m3_4, #sddm div a.m3_4:hover{ background-position:-180px -90px;}


/*顶部右*/
.top_r{ float:right; width:550px; height:41px; }


/*顶部公共栏*/
.member{position:relative;}
.member #logDiv{position:absolute; top:28px; left:0px; top:35px; width:240px; /*display:none;*/}
.member span {color:#333333;float:left;font-size:12px;line-height:24px;margin:0 3px;}
#UserLog {float:right; margin-right:11px; margin-top:0px;_margin-top:1px; Letter-spacing:2px; position:relative;}
#UserLog div{ color:#fff;}
.member a {line-height:26px;_line-height:24px; color:#fff;}
.member .dlzc { padding:1px 15px 0 0;}
.member .dlzc li{ float:left; padding:0 5px;}
.member .dlzc a{ display:inline-block; width:46px; height:22px; font:12px/22px "宋体"; color:#fff; text-align:center; text-decoration:none; background:url(top_img.gif) no-repeat 0 -189px;}
.member .dlzc a:visited{ color:#fff;}
.member .dlzc .none a{ width:auto; background:none;}
.member .logBox{border:1px solid #ccc; background-color:#FFF; padding:20px 25px; color:#666;}
.member .logBox p{ display:inline-block; margin:2px 0;}
#UserLog .logBox{ color:#666;}
.member .logBox .logInp{float:left; width:185px; height:24px; margin:2px 0; font-size:13px; line-height:24px; color:#999; text-indent:6px; border:1px solid #DDDDDD;}
.member .logBox .dlbut{ margin-top:3px;}
.member .logBox .dltips a{ color:#CC0000;}
.member .logBox a{color:#000;}
.member .logBox .logBtn{width:185px; height:26px; margin-right:10px; font:bold 14px/24px "宋体"; color:#fff; text-align:center; border:1px solid #ff8d30; background:#ffac69;}
.member span span.mr10 a{margin-left:2px;line-height:22px;line-height:24px \9;_line-height:28px; text-decoration:none; font-weight:100; padding:10px 0; color:#FFFFFF;}
.member span span.mr10{ margin-left:0;}
.member span.fr em{width:11px; height:5px; display:inline;color:#999;padding:0 3px;/*background:url(../NImages/down.gif) no-repeat center 0px; float:left;*/ margin-top:10px;}
.member span.fr em img{*padding-top:5px;}
#topBar .sc{ height:32px; line-height:32px; float: right;margin-left: 10px;padding-top: 0; color:#aaa;}
.welcome{height:33px; line-height:30px; float:left;}
.member span em{ color:#999;padding-left:4px;}
.member {float:left; height:20px; margin-top:11px; display:inline;}
.member span {color:#333333;float:left;font-size:12px;line-height:24px;margin:0 5px 0 3px;}
.member .name {background:url(indeximg.gif) no-repeat scroll left 3px;height:18px;padding-left:20px;}
.member #formLog input{ float:left;margin-top:4px;*margin-top:1px; }
.member #formLog .inputtext{border:1px solid #e0e0e0;float:left;height:17px;line-height:17px;width:100px;margin:0 3px 0 0; _margin-top:0px;}
.member #formLog .bt{margin-top:-2px;background:url(indeximg.gif) no-repeat 0 -24px;_background-position:0 -26px;border:medium none;color:#666;font-size:12px;height:23px;margin:-2px 0 0 5px;_margin:0 0 0 5px;padding-bottom:0px;*padding-top:5px;_padding-top:1px;text-align:center;width:40px; float:left;}
.member #formLog .bt2 {background:url(indeximg.gif) no-repeat 0 -26px;border:medium none;color:#f30;font-size:12px;height:24px;margin:0px 6px 0 2px;_margin:0 6px 0 2px;text-align:center;width:38px; float:left;line-height:22px;*line-height:24px;}
/*账号切换区域*/
#MemberMenu .hello{ float:left; height:24px; line-height:24px;}
#MemberMenu .join{ float:left; height:24px; line-height:20px; line-height:24px \9; font-family:Arial; margin-top:-2px; margin-top:0px \9; _margin-top:-1px;}
#MemberMenu .join a{ margin:0 3px;line-height:24px \9;}
#MemberMenu .join a#fastPost{ padding:5px 0 5px 21px; background:url(top_img.gif) no-repeat -60px -19px;}
#MemberMenu .join a.MemberCenter{ padding:5px 0 5px 18px; background:url(top_img.gif) no-repeat -60px -54px;}
#MemberMenu .join a.exit{ padding:5px 0 5px 7px;}
#zone-bar { height:20px;padding:0; float:left;font-family:Arial;}
#zone-bar ul {display: block;}
#pw_box ul i{width:11px; height:5px; display:inline;color:#999;padding:0 3px;background:url(../NImages/down.gif) no-repeat center -15px; float:left; margin-top:10px; position:absolute; top:-31px;_top:-29px; right:2px;_right:36px}
/*微博及QQ登陆*/
.loginWays{ width:122px; height:22px; margin:10px 0 0; text-align:left;}
.loginWays img{float:left;margin-top:4px;margin-right:4px;}
.loginWays .firstWay,.loginWays .text{display:block; padding-left:5px; color:#666; line-height:20px;}
.loginWays .firstWay{height:24px; line-height:25px; overflow:hidden; margin-bottom:5px; background:url(bg_loginways.png) no-repeat 0 0; cursor:pointer;}
.loginWays .firstWay:hover{background:url(bg_loginwaysA.png)}
.loginWays .firstWay span{float:left; color:#333;}
.loginWays .firstWay span.iconDown{display:none}
.otherWays{margin-top:15px;}
.waysList{}
.waysList li{float:left;margin-top:8px; margin-right:10px; height:16px; line-height:17px; overflow:hidden;}
.waysList li img{float:left; margin-right:4px;}
#menu_weibo_login{ top:32px;}
#menu_weibo_login a{ height:22px; line-height:22px;}
/*menu*/
.pw_menu{ Letter-spacing:0px; border:1px solid #e0e0e0; background:#fff; position:absolute; top:32px; z-index:999;}
#name_open{left:20px;}
#fastPost_open{left:118px;}
.pw_menuBg{padding:0 10px 10px;}
.pw_menu h6{ position:absolute;margin-top:-20px;height:17px;border:1px solid #ccc;background:#fff;border-bottom:0;right:-1px;padding:0 4px;*padding:0 5px;line-height:18px; white-space:nowrap;}
.pw_menu h6 img{*margin-top:2px;}
.menuList{background:#fff; padding:1px; margin:0; _width:90px;}
.menuList li{width:100%;}
#MemberMenu .join .menuList a{ margin:0;}
.menuList a{line-height:25px; height:25px; padding:0 10px; margin:0; color:#585858; display:block; overflow:hidden;}
.menuList a:hover{background:#eaf9ff; text-decoration:none;color:#666;}
.menuList .btn1 a, .menuList .btn2 a, .menuList .btn3 a, .menuList .btn4 a{ height:28px; margin:0; padding:0 5px 0 24px; line-height:28px; color:#585858; background:url(top_img.gif) no-repeat; display:block; overflow:hidden;}
.menuList .btn1 a:hover, .menuList .btn2 a:hover, .menuList .btn3 a:hover, .menuList .btn4 a:hover{background:url(top_img.gif) no-repeat #eaf9ff; text-decoration:none;color:#666;}
.menuList .btn1 a, .menuList .btn1 a:hover{ background-position:-55px -86px;}
.menuList .btn2 a, .menuList .btn2 a:hover{ background-position:-55px -114px;}
.menuList .btn3 a, .menuList .btn3 a:hover{ background-position:-55px -142px;}
.menuList .btn4 a, .menuList .btn4 a:hover{ background-position:-55px -170px;}
.menuList img{ vertical-align:text-bottom;white-space:nowrap;margin-left:-5px;_margin-top:4px;margin-right:5px;}
.menuListB li{float:left;width:10%;height:23px;margin:0;overflow:hidden;}
.menuListC li{float:left;white-space:nowrap;}
#consolePanel{z-index:10001;position:fixed;top:0px;left:0px;width:100%;padding:5px 0; text-align:center;background:#ffffdb;border-bottom:2px solid #F60;_position: absolute;_top: expression(documentElement . scrollTop);}
/*增加消息提示*/
.msg{ height:31px; Letter-spacing:0px; position:absolute; top:30px; left:38px; z-index:990;}
.msg .mL,.msg .mC,.msg .mR{ height:31px; float:left; background:url(xmsg.gif) no-repeat; overflow:hidden;}
.msg .mL{ width:23px; background-position:0 0;}
.msg .mC{ line-height:36px; font-size:12px; background-repeat:repeat-x; background-position:0 -31px; color:#ff6600; }
.msg .mC a{ color:#666; line-height:36px; font-size:12px; text-decoration:none; }
.msg .mC span{line-height:36px; float:none; color:#c00; margin:0 3px;}
.msg .mR{ width:6px; background-position:right -62px;}